Interaction of Dietary Fat and Soybean Isolate (SBI) on Azaserine-induced Pancreatic Carcinogenesis

Abstract:Raw soybean flour contains high levels of both soybean trypsin inhibitor and unsaturated fat. The chronic ingestion of this flour enhances pancreatic carcinogenesis in rats that have been treated with pancreatic carcinogens. In these studies we have examined the separate and combined effects of trypsin inhibitor in purified soybean isolate (SBI) and a high level of unsaturated fat fed during the postinitiation phase of pancreatic carcinogenesis. Male Wistar rats were injected with the known pancreatic carcinogen azaserine (30 mg/kg, ip) 14 days after birth and were weaned to the test diets. No further exposure to carcinogen occurred. Dietary composition (% by weight) of fat (corn oil) was either 5%, or for the high fat group 20%. Dietary protein (20% in all diets) was supplied as either casein, or heated or raw SBI. All diets were fedad libitum for the postinitiation phase. The number and size of transections of azaserine-induced putative, preneoplastic foci and the volume of pancreas occupied by these foci were determined by light microscopy. High fat diet increased the number and transectional size of the azaserine-induced foci as compared to the control (5% corn oil) group. The volume of pancreas occupied by foci doubled. Heated SBI had no effect upon the foci. Raw SBI, however, significantly increased the number and size of foci. The combination of raw SBI plus the high fat diet elicited an increase in focal growth that was greater than that produced by either component alone. These observations indicated that both trypsin inhibitor and the high unsaturated fat content of raw soy flour contribute to the enhancement or promotion of pancreatic carcinogenesis.
